What is Kuwait Embassy Attestation?

Kuwait Embassy Attestation is the process of verifying the authenticity of documents issued in your home country, ensuring they are valid and recognized in Kuwait. This process involves multiple steps and can apply to a wide range of documents, such as:

  • Educational certificates (degree, diploma, etc.)
  • Personal documents (birth certificates, marriage certificates, etc.)
  • Commercial documents (invoices, power of attorney, etc.)

Without proper attestation, your documents may not be accepted by Kuwaiti authorities for visa processing, employment, higher education, or business purposes.

Why is Attestation Necessary?

The Government of Kuwait mandates that all foreign documents be attested to prevent fraud and ensure the documents are genuine. This attestation serves several purposes:

  • Employment: Employers require attested educational and professional certificates.
  • Family Visa: Birth and marriage certificates need attestation for dependent or spouse visas.
  • Education: Universities in Kuwait demand attested academic records for admissions.
  • Business Setup: Legal and commercial documents must be authenticated for business operations.

The Process of Kuwait Embassy Attestation

Attesting your documents for Kuwait involves several stages, including local verification in your home country and attestation by the Kuwait Embassy. Here’s a breakdown of the process:

  • Notary Attestation: The first step involves attestation by a local notary to confirm the document’s legitimacy.
  • State Attestation: Depending on the type of document, it must be verified by the relevant state authority (e.g., Education Department for academic records).
  • Ministry of External Affairs (MEA): The MEA authenticates the document, indicating that it has been verified by a central authority.
  • Kuwait Embassy Attestation: Finally, the document is submitted to the Kuwait Embassy or Consulate for the final attestation.

Challenges in the Attestation Process

Attestation can be a time-consuming and complicated task, especially if you’re unfamiliar with the process. Here are some common challenges:

Lengthy Procedures: The multiple stages can take weeks or even months to complete.

Complex Requirements: Different documents have different requirements, and missing a single step can delay the process.

Frequent Rejections: Incomplete or improperly attested documents are often rejected, requiring you to start over.
